What’s my platform?
I do not have one other than the fact that I have a real desire to
ensure that Logan County remains a strong agricultural community.
I was born and raised on a farm and married to a Logan county farmer
and raised two sons who are now taking over our farming operation.
The drought of 1988 forced me back into the workplace. I was
employed at Tri-County Sp. Education and the Regional Office of
Education from August 1988 thru Feb. 2008. During that time I
closely followed the “workings” of our Logan County Board.

 After my retirement, and a board seat becoming
available in my Dist., I feel I am ready to participate and I will
work diligently to represent my constituents to the best of my
ability. If I’m elected, I will bring knowledge and varied life
experiences. I not only want to represent everyone within my Dist.
but I want to work with the entire Board to bring jobs and new
business opportunities in an effort to keep our young people in
Lincoln and Logan County.
